I got focus on the photo and double tapped, flicked up to show details, then double tapped on the detected text button. For those who do not know about cross stitch, it is using thread on a cloth mat and making fancy letters and a design around the border. It is in a wooden frame. It is almost a cross between hand writing and calligraphy. Then, I used the VoiceOver 3 finger quadruple tap to copy what VoiceOver said to the clipboard. This is my first experiment with this. I will put the corrected version immediately following what iOS 15 did with the photo. Detected text * Have courage por the great sorrows of Life, fund patience por the small ones. find when you have laboriously Accomplished your dally tasks, 60 to sleep in Peace Bod is Awake. to sleep in Peace Actual text: Have courage for the great sorrows of life And patience for the small ones And when you have laboriously accomplished your daily tasks, Go to sleep in peace, God is awake. I'm not sure why it repeats "sleep in peace" but it does. I think it is a pretty good job for something that is very difficult to scan with any OCR software and being just part of the camera feature in iOS 15. Apple deserves credit for making it easy to find out what something says just by using the built-in camera. Also, Voice Dream Scanner did not do any better than the camera did. Another thing that is certainly more active since much of the processing is done on the phone is that if VoiceOver is focused on the View Finder, it will start speaking the objects in the view finder immediately.
